Adaptive Neural Network Control (ANNC) is a control strategy used for induction motor speed regulation, aiming to improve the motor's performance in terms of speed tracking and disturbance rejection. It combines the advantages of adaptive control and neural networks to provide a robust and adaptive solution. Below are the main principles of Adaptive Neural Network Control for induction motor speed regulation:
Neural Network Representation: ANNC employs a neural network to approximate the complex and nonlinear dynamics of the induction motor. The neural network is typically a multi-layer perceptron (MLP) or a radial basis function (RBF) network. The network takes motor inputs, such as stator currents, voltages, and rotor speed, and provides the corresponding control actions as outputs.
Online Adaptation: The key feature of ANNC is its ability to adapt in real-time based on the system's dynamic behavior. As the motor operates, it continuously updates the parameters of the neural network to learn the motor's characteristics and changes in the environment.
Error-driven Learning: ANNC uses an error-driven learning mechanism to adjust the neural network's weights and biases. The error is computed as the difference between the desired motor speed and the actual measured speed. The neural network learns from this error to optimize its parameters and improve the control performance.
Model Reference Adaptive System (MRAS): To achieve online adaptation, ANNC often incorporates a Model Reference Adaptive System. MRAS provides an estimate of the motor's parameters based on the difference between the actual system output and the output predicted by a reference model. The adaptive neural network uses this parameter estimate to adjust its own parameters and enhance the control action.
Robustness and Disturbance Rejection: ANNC aims to improve the robustness of the induction motor control system by handling parameter variations, external disturbances, and uncertainties in the system. The neural network's adaptive capabilities enable it to adapt to these variations and disturbances, leading to improved performance and accuracy.
Stability Analysis: Stability is a critical aspect of control systems. ANNC incorporates stability analysis to ensure that the control algorithm remains stable under various operating conditions. Stability is achieved by carefully designing the adaptation laws and control algorithms.
Reduced Sensitivity to Variations: Induction motors often experience changes in their electrical parameters and mechanical load conditions. ANNC helps mitigate the sensitivity of the control system to these variations, resulting in better speed regulation and performance.
Nonlinear Control Performance: The neural network approximates the nonlinear characteristics of the induction motor, enabling ANNC to achieve better control performance than traditional linear control techniques.
In summary, Adaptive Neural Network Control for induction motor speed regulation combines the adaptive capabilities of neural networks with the robustness of adaptive control strategies to provide a flexible and efficient control solution, which can improve the motor's speed regulation and disturbance rejection in the face of uncertainties and changes in the operating environment.